IGCSE Literature teachers wanting to receive information and engage in a debate on the options for 2025 and 2026 IGCSE Literature exam
- To explore set texts for IGCSE Literature selection 2025/2026 by providing background information on author and context, a general overview of plot and major themes exposed to determine how age appropriate each text may be.
- To comment on the options for poetry: Songs of Ourselves versus single-author selections.
- To look into Drama alternatives by considering author, setting, language, themes and degree of relatability with students of specific age groups.
- To share teaching experiences regarding previous selections, how they worked in class, student response to them and general criteria for text selection.

- Presentation of Set Texts for Literature IGCSE 2025/2026 for Poetry, Prose and Drama.
- Introduction to the authors, genre, plot, themes and linguistic complexities of each choice.
- Discussion of the pros and cons of each choice regarding target age, time needed for in-depth analysis and suitability of each text for a passage-based exam.
- Sharing of experiences, advice and personal views.
